First Flock-Herd Grant Deadline Nears

Are you or someone you know a young person dreaming of raising sheep or goats? The RSG Foundation’s First Flock-Herd Grant is designed to help youth across the country get started in livestock by awarding funding toward the purchase of their very first breeding ewe or doe.

The application is open to youth ages 8–20 who are passionate about agriculture and ready to take the next step in livestock ownership. Applicants will be asked to share their goals, experience, and how they plan to care for and grow their new flock or herd.

Premier 1 Supplies Renews Support

The RSG Foundation would like to thank Premier 1 Supplies for their renewed support of the First Flock-Herd grant program.

The Foundation’s goal is to award 20 breeding sheep & goats to youth across the country to help them get started in raising small ruminants. Premier 1 Supplies has committed to providing a $500 gift certificate to each grant winner to purchase supplies from premier1supplies.com.

This makes Premier 1 Supplies’ commitment for 2026 at $10,000! The Foundation matches this gift with $500 cash award in addition to a breeding animal.

Applications are due by October 1, 2025 for animals to be awarded on January 15th, 2026.

Donate Products and Services to our Annual Holiday Auction

The RSG Foundation will hold our annual Holiday Auction in November on Willoughby Online Sales. If you have products or services you would like to donate to support this effort, please email us at: lisa.edge@rsgfoundationinc.org

In the past, breeders have donated genetics, fishing trips, on-farm experiences, artwork, handmade items, and more.

Your support helps us raise funds for youth education, grants, thought leadership programs, and other initiatives to support the sustainability of the small ruminant industry.

Auction Date: November 18th, 2025

Donations due by October 31st.

All donors receive an acknowledgment letter of your donation to our 501-c3. If you itemize deductions on your federal tax return, you may be entitled to claim a charitable deduction for your RSG Foundation donations.
